GE’s new GPGPU platforms are particu-
larly well-suited to many of the processing
needs of Military and Aerospace applica-
tions where size, weight and power are key
considerations along with resistance to
extended temperature, shock and vibration.
GPGPU technology allows system designers
to pack more punch into less space and use
less power for your applications.
The graph shows GFLOPs performance
for the VSIPL multiple FFT operation. It
compares performance on different GE
Intelligent Platforms embedded platforms;
a GPU platform, multi-core Intel Penryn and
i5 platforms and an e600 based PowerPC
platform. GE’s platform-optimized AXISLib
DSP library product is used on all platforms.
Data is in GPU memory for the GPU case
and in-cache for the Intel and PPC cases.
